PHYSICAL DESCRIPTION
An ordinary example of his people, this Umbaran had a sunken look to his angular features accented by blue and purple makeup — had it not been for an impish grin that softened him to a degree, he would appear not unlike some sort of vengeful ghoul. He had an athletic build that he maintained less through concentrated effort and more so the basic necessities of his occupation. His eyes were pale blue, his skin was a chalky white, and his head perfectly devoid of hair. He was of moderate height and held himself casually, leaning and shrugging his weight this way and that. His hands were carefully maintained and his nails were painted a matte black to match his lipstick.

PUBLIC DATA
Myr Dhurri, also known as Shadowdancer, was an Umbaran male technician who served in the Umbaran Militia but had since left the service to become an entrepreneur aboard The Wheel space station. It was there he established Shadowdancer Staryard, a humble, neighborhood garage.

The eighth son of Aryll and Phanir was born to the Dhurri family of the Technician's caste in the old House system on Umbara in the Liroll province. Myr lived an unremarkable life for an Umbaran and was raised in the standard way that all children of the Dhurri family had been for the past thousand years: to understand machines. Following completion of his primary education, Myr enlisted in the Umbaran Militia and served for twenty years. In that lengthy career, he defended his homeworld from raids conducted by foreign powers and achieved the rank of Foreman in the militia's Technical division, but the gradual loss of friends and destruction he had witnessed took its toll and he resigned his commission on the twentieth anniversary of his enlistment.

Myr used his newfound freedom to sell his home and relocate to The Wheel, a large station in the Besh Gorgon system where he worked as a mechanic and parts dealer. In his downtime, he ventured out into the wider galaxy to acquire new parts to sell and make a name for himself.
